Ansible是一个自动化的IT工具,通过使用Ansible可以实现自动化地部署、配置和管理IT系统。而Ansible的一个重要特性就是其幂等性。幂等性是指无论应用一次还是多次,其结果都是一致的。在Ansible中,幂等性确保了在执行Playbook(Ansible中的配置文件)时,不管运行多少次,系统都会处于一个稳定的状态。

通过实现幂等性,Ansible能够确保每次执行Playbook时都能够按照预期的结果完成操作。这使得管理者可以放心地重复执行操作,而不必担心会引发不一致的结果。这不仅减少了人为错误的发生概率,同时也提高了系统的可靠性和稳定性。

幂等性也使得Ansible的配置更加灵活和可靠。在日常运维工作中,系统管理员需要频繁地对服务器进行配置和部署。而通过Ansible的幂等性特性,管理员可以确保每次执行Playbook时,只会对系统进行必要的操作,而不会不必要的重复配置。这不仅节省了管理员的时间和精力,同时也降低了出错的可能性。

另外,幂等性也提高了Ansible在大型系统中的适用性。在一个复杂的IT环境中,可能包括多个不同的服务器和网络设备。通过Ansible实现幂等性,管理员可以轻松地管理大规模的系统,而不必担心复杂的依赖关系和操作顺序。这使得在动态和异构的IT环境中实现自动化操作变得更加容易。

总的来说,Ansible的幂等性是其一个重要的特性,它保证了在自动化操作中的可靠性和一致性。通过实现幂等性,Ansible不仅简化了系统管理的工作流程,减少了人为错误的发生,同时也提高了整个IT系统的稳定性和可靠性。因此,对于那些希望提高系统管理效率和减少人工干预的企业来说,Ansible的幂等性将是一个不可或缺的特性。